Scholarships for Military Children
$2,000
Overview
The Scholarships for Military Children Program honors the sacrifices of military families and recognizes the commissary’s contribution to the military community by awarding college scholarships to eligible dependent children.
Important dates (2026–2027 academic year)
- Application window: December 10, 2025 – February 11, 2026.
- Notification: Recipients will be notified by mail on or about May 15, 2026. Because of the large number of applications, those not selected will not receive a notification.
Awards
- For the 2026–2027 school year, 500 scholarships of $2,000 each will be awarded.

South Dakota Opportunity Scholarship
$7,500
In 2003, the South Dakota Legislature initiated the Regents Scholarship Program, aimed at providing affordable education to the state's top high school graduates. This program applies to any university, college, or technical school in South Dakota accredited by the Higher Learning Commission of the North Central Association of Colleges and Schools. The following year, the scholarship was renamed the South Dakota Opportunity Scholarship (SDOS) and was funded by the state's Education Enhancement Trust Fund, starting with the 2004 high school graduating classes.

HGA Dendel Scholarship
$4,000
Introduction
The Handweavers Guild of America, Inc. (HGA) provides two undergraduate/graduate scholarships — the HGA Scholarship and the Dendel Scholarship — for students enrolled in accredited fiber-arts programs in the United States and Canada. These awards support advanced study in fiber arts, including textile research, textile history, and textile conservation. Selection is based on artistic and technical excellence and/or distinguished scholarship in textiles; awards are not made on the basis of financial need. Annually, scholarship awards total $4,000 or more for the academic year.

Angel Calzadilla Memorial Scholarship
$6,100
Overview
The Miami Police Department’s Do The Right Thing (DTRT) initiative is offering a memorial scholarship to support young adults who want to pursue a career in law enforcement. The program honors the legacy of a cherished officer who died in 2011 and aims to help community-minded applicants train as City of Miami police officers.
About the Scholarship

Walter Byers Graduate Scholarship
$24,000
Overview The Walter Byers Graduate Scholarship is the NCAA’s top academic honor, created to acknowledge and support extraordinary student-athletes who pair excellent academic records with notable leadership and service. Named after Walter Byers, the NCAA’s first executive director, the award helps recipients pursue graduate studies in any discipline. Evans Scholarship
$12,000
Overview
The Evans Scholarship covers full college tuition plus room and board for accomplished caddies who demonstrate financial need. Eligible candidates must show a strong history as a caddie, solid academic performance, clear financial need, and exemplary character.
Who may apply
- High school students may submit applications at the start of their senior year. College freshmen are also eligible to apply.
Eligibility criteria
- Caddie record: Applicants should have caddied regularly and successfully for at least two years and are expected to be actively caddying at their sponsoring club during the year they apply.
